wohlfahrtia

noun wohl·fahr·tia \ˌvōl-ˈfärt-ē-ə\

Medical Definition of WOHLFAHRTIA

1
capitalized :  a genus of larviparous dipteran flies of the family Sarcophagidae that commonly deposit their larvae in wounds or on the intact skin of humans and domestic animals causing severe cutaneous myiasis
2
:  any fly of the genus Wohlfahrtia

Biographical Note for WOHLFAHRTIA

Wol·fart \ˈvōl-ˌfärt\ , Peter (1675–1726), German physician. Wolfart was a practicing physician in Hanau, Germany, as well as a professor of medicine and anatomy, first at the secondary school and later at the college there.
